The article recollects notable IPL moments from 2008 to 2016. It includes Brendon McCullum's opening night knock, Rajasthan Royals' 2008 win, Chris Gayle's 175-run innings, the 'Slapgate' controversy, and Mumbai Indians' 2015 last-ball final. It highlights high tension, dramatic games, and unforgettable performances that defined the early years of the league.

Renuka Singh Thakur's maiden five-wicket haul (5/29) propelled India to a resounding 211-run victory over the West Indies in the first Women's ODI at Vadodara. Her devastating in-swingers, honed since her youth, decimated the West Indies batting lineup, leaving them all out for a paltry 103.
Australia face a significant setback as senior pacer Josh Hazlewood is likely to miss the two-Test series against Sri Lanka due to a recurring calf issue and side strain. This, coupled with Pat Cummins' unavailability, weakens Australia's pace attack. Selectors prioritize Hazlewood's long-term fitness ahead of the Ashes and WTC final.

Shubman Gill showcased his extraordinary form in the ODI series against England by scoring a century during the third and final match, marking his seventh century in ODIs. Achieving this in just 50 innings, he became the fastest Indian batter to reach this landmark and only the fifth overall to score a century at a single venue across all formats.
The Pakistan Cricket Board has dismissed rumors of removing Imran Khan's name from an enclosure at Gaddafi Stadium due to his imprisonment on corruption charges. They confirmed that names of all enclosures remain unchanged. Imran Khan, facing a 14-year sentence, claims the accusations are politically motivated.

Gautam Gambhir's tenure as India's head coach faces scrutiny with mixed results across formats so far. While successful in T20Is (6/6 wins), the Test performance, especially the 1-3 defeat in Australia and batting issues, raises concerns. Support staff's effectiveness is also under scrutiny going forward. India's next Test assignment is the five-match series in England in June-July.
